Abstract

A drive system for a marine vessel includes a first housing fixed to an opening in a hull of the marine vessel, and a drive unit arranged inside the first housing. The drive unit has a second housing comprising an electric or combustion drive motor and a marine propulsion system attached to the second housing, where the drive system is provided with a parking position in which the marine propulsion system is positioned inside the first housing, a drive position in which the marine propulsion system is positioned outside of the first housing, where the first housing is provided with an inwardly extending flange arranged around the circumference of the opening, and that the second housing is provided with an edge at the circumference of a lower side of the second housing, where the flange shape and the edge shape are complementary, such that the edge of the second housing bears on the flange of the first housing when the drive system is in the drive position.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A drive system for a marine vessel comprising a first housing provided with an opening and being fixed to an opening inside a hull of the marine vessel, and a drive unit arranged inside the first housing, where the drive unit comprises a second housing comprising a drive motor and a marine propulsion system attached to the second housing, where the marine propulsion system comprises a leg and a hub provided with at least one propeller, where the drive system comprises an adjustment mechanism arranged to adjust the position of the drive unit in the first housing, where the drive system is provided with a parking position in which the marine propulsion system is positioned inside the first housing and a drive position in which the marine propulsion system is positioned outside of the first housing, wherein the first housing is provided with an inwardly extending flange having a flange shape, where the inwardly extending flange is arranged around the circumference of the opening, and that the second housing is provided with an edge at the circumference of a lower side of the second housing, having an edge shape complementary to the flange shape, such that the edge of the second housing bears on the flange of the first housing when the drive system is in the drive position, characterized in that the first housing is arranged to be resiliently connected to the hull of the marine vessel. 
     
     
         2 . Drive system according to  claim 1 , wherein the first housing is arranged to be resiliently connected to the hull of the marine vessel by means of at least one O-ring arranged above and below a protrusion arranged at a lower end of the first housing. 
     
     
         3 . Drive system according to  claim 2 , wherein the O-rings have a material thickness of 3-50 mm. 
     
     
         4 . Drive system according to  claim 1 , wherein the drive motor is an electric drive motor. 
     
     
         5 . Drive system according to  claim 1 , wherein the drive motor is an internal combustion engine. 
     
     
         6 . Drive system according to  claim 1 , wherein the flange shape and the edge shape is tapered. 
     
     
         7 . Drive system according to  claim 6 , wherein the angle of the tapered flange of the first housing and the edge of the second housing is between 30 to 60 degrees with respect to a vertical axis of the drive system. 
     
     
         8 . Drive system according to  claim 7 , wherein the angle of the tapered flange of the first housing and the edge of the second housing is between 40 to 50 degrees with respect to a vertical axis of the drive system. 
     
     
         9 . Drive system according to  claim 1 , wherein the flange of the first housing further comprises a seal and/or the edge of the second housing further comprises a seal. 
     
     
         10 . Drive system according to  claim 1 , wherein the outer shape of the first housing and the second housing is circular. 
     
     
         11 . Drive system according to  claim 1 , wherein the outer shape of the first housing and the second housing is non-circular. 
     
     
         12 . Drive system according to  claim 1 , wherein the second housing is rotationally adjustable in the first housing. 
     
     
         13 . Drive system according to  claim 1 , wherein the second housing is rotationally fixed in the first housing. 
     
     
         14 . Drive system according to  claim 1 , wherein the drive unit is provided with a locking means that is adapted to lock the adjustment mechanism in the selected position. 
     
     
         15 . Marine vessel, comprising at least one drive system according to  claim 1 .
